Krafton Collaborates with Solana Labs

by Bilal Jafar
  • The creator of PUBG has signed a business agreement with Solana Labs.
  • The partnership will support the design and marketing of blockchain-based games and services.
blockchain

Blockchain services provider, Solana Labs recently became the latest firm to expand its presence in the global gaming ecosystem through a long-term cooperation agreement with Krafton, the creator of the popular PUBG game.

Through the collaboration, both companies are planning to assist the development and operation of blockchain and NFT-based games and services. Moreover, Krafton and Solana will jointly cooperate on investment opportunities.

“KRAFTON will continuously see ways to work closely with blockchain companies like Solana Labs as we work toward establishing our Web 3.0 ecosystem,” said Hyungchul Park, Lead of Web 3.0 Roundtable at KRAFTON, Inc. “As one of the best global high-performance blockchain with strength in high speed and low fees, Solana represents the best of the Web 3.0 ecosystem and its technologies. Through this cooperation, KRAFTON will acquire the insight needed to accelerate its investment in and output of blockchain-based experiences.”

Blockchain-based gaming services have created a massive buzz in the Web 3.0 ecosystem. Earlier this month, Binance Labs, the venture capital arm and innovation incubator of Binance, announced an investment in AlwaysGeeky Games to support the development in the blockchain gaming industry.

Krafton

With a strong presence in the international gaming industry, Krafton is planning to increase its Web 3.0 and non-fungible token capabilities. In the past few months, Krafton has announced several partnerships with companies related to NFT, metaverse and blockchain, including Seoul Auction Blue, XX Blue and NAVER Z (Zepeto).

“We’re excited by KRAFTON’s commitment to building the future of gaming on Solana,” said Johnny Lee, the Head of Games Business Development at Solana Labs. “KRAFTON is an established innovator in the games industry, and we are excited to be part of their next level up. We are seeing gamers increasingly seek out on-chain games and gaming companies who respond quickly to this demand will set themselves up well for ongoing success.”
